Nieoficjalne info z forum.blu-ray.com na temat anulowanego UHD z pierwszym Terminatorem:
Cytat:A label (not Shout, Arrow, or Criterion) had The Terminator but was dropped when they discovered any additional transfer work or HDR grading on the 4k SDR master would require James Cameron's approval due to DGA rules. Whoever had it could've used the 4k SDR transfer as-is and just put the original mono and alt Chase stereo tracks on to make ppl happy, but they probably felt a UHD was needed for this one as T2 has (a very poor) one. As Cameron is tied up with 5 Avatar sequels and dealing with 20th Century Disney changes, they felt it wouldn't be worth wait for him to supervise HDR work by the time the licence runs out within 3-5 years.
